Description:
This is your chance to learn basic Dutch in the Netherlands. Working interactively in our state-of-the-art digital language lab, you develop reasonable speaking, listening, reading and writing skills and build a core vocabulary and a grounding in Dutch grammar. In the classroom you work with
video, audio and computer tools – to simulate telephone conversations, for example.
But this is more than just a language course. You also learn about Dutch culture and society, and explore some of the highlights of the country’s history. What was so special about the famous Golden Age? Have the Dutch really always battled against the water? You also look at the stereotypes
associated with the Netherlands and its culture, and place them in an historical context. By the end of the course, some of your preconceived ideas – about “liberal” Dutch attitudes towards drugs, sexuality and immigration, for instance – might be in need of serious reconsideration!
